<h2 style="text-align: left;">Details: Custom 404 Page</h2>
<p>As I explained in the post about <a href="http://martythornley.com/2009/11/custom-photography-blog-jules-bianchi-photography" target="_self">another site</a>, the 404 error page is one of the most overlooked aspects of any site. A site should be able to handle when something goes wrong. If you have ever reached a site that said something like &#8216;The Page you are looking for can not be found,&#8221; you are looking at what is called a 404 error page. 404 refers to the numerical code thrown back to the browser by the server. Generally, these pages are ugly and not very helpful. The standard WordPress 404 will simply provide a serach box, if anything and will probably be a plain page. But wouldn&#8217;t it be more helpful to provide suggestions for what the visitor might be looking for?</p>
<p>It is possible to add an instant search result to these pages, using the url that the person was looking for. Rather than saying the site can not find that page, we have the site do a quick search and see if it finds anything close. This is great because a lot of these errors are just misspellings or typos. But the search will probably find it. Just in case the search fails, I also have it list the categories and archives links.</p>
<p>To see it in action try this link <a href="http://plumtreestudios.com/blog/ wedding photograph" target="_blank">http://plumtreestudios.com/blog/ wedding photograph</a>. You can see that there are blank spaces in the link and there is definitely no URL there. But instead of an error, the site offers several posts that relate to those locations.</p>

<h2 style="text-align: left;">Details: Custom Site Options</h2>
<p>Across the top of most blogs, you could display the title and description of the blog, have a single image as the header (possibly an image that includes a logo, or the title of the site), or you could do something fancy like a fading slideshow of images. Picking any one of these would mean being stuck with it unless you know how to edit code yourself or want to hire your web guy again for changes.</p>
<p>So I have started including an options area in all my sites where the user can select any of the three options at any time. Not only that, the fading slideshow I use reads any image you put in a folder. All you have to do is upload images to the folder to change your slideshow. If you ever get sick of the fading images, just change the option and upload a single image right in the WordPress admin area.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p style="text-align: left;">Here is a quick look at a blog I did for <a href="http://andrenaphoto.com/blog" target="_blank">Andrena Photography</a>. Based in Los Angeles Andrena is an amazing photographer, best known for her Indian Weddings. As proof, you will notice amongst the list of referrals on her blog, a listing for Elephant Rentals.</p>
<p style="text-align: left;">With an existing website and a strong brand and logo already in place, I simply had to adjust colors and fonts to match the existing site. For the background image, I had to create a new image using the background of the current site, filling in the middle portion where the website sits. There were also some custom programming tweaks to make the menu work the way we wanted, fix the layouts of the category pages, etc. Then I added the standard set of WordPress plugins to help with optimizing the site&#8217;s performance.</p>
<p style="text-align: left;">For better visibility in the search engines, I added the All in One SEO Pack plugin for WordPress. It allows you to customize the all important title tag for every page of your site. For the title tags, we used &#8216;Los Angeles Wedding Photographer, Indian Wedding Photographer&#8217;. The site currently ranks in Google at #5 for &#8216;Los Angeles Wedding Photographer&#8217; and #4 for &#8216;Indian Wedding Photographer&#8217;.</p>
